The New Zealand Government has launched a COVID-19 ‘digital diary’ app. The App is a way to help Kiwis keep track of where they’ve been and assist in contact tracing. The idea is that businesses and shops use the app to help record those people coming onto their premises. The App has been developed by the Ministry of Health. Prime Minister Jacinda Ardern says the new Government app will let people record where they’ve been and when, all while keeping the data to themselves.
